Riots between rival fans (Panathinaikos-Olympiakos) took place yesterday in Peania (Athens suburbs).

As a result we had 1 dead (Panathinaikos fan), tens of injured (stubbed, hit on the head, run over by cars)

4 second division football club Marko players stubbed, beaten and robbed by Olympiakos fans cause they wore green shirts and were going to training.

3 stores smashed, several cars burnt.

As that was not enough the riots continued in the hospital in which the injured fans were taken between the fans 'friends' who arrived later there.

Late on evening new riots again between Panathinaikos-Olympiakos took place in Chaidari (Athens), again we had many injuried by stubbings, beating etc

As one eye-witness said he saw one Olympiakos fan shouting to another 'what are you looking at? Kill him, Finish him, he is a 'vazelos' (Panathinaikos fan)'

And all that for a meaningless WOMEN VOLLEYBALL match between Panathinaikos and Olympiakos.

So far more than 30 people have been arrested, but the murderer is still out there.

Thus all sports events have been cancelled for the next 2 weeks in Greece.

The Olympiakos fans started their 'death comvoy' at their Football Stadium in Piraeus with more than 100 motorbikes and over 200 people, they rode the 30 kilometres distance to Peania with Police escort riding across Athens.

Out of the arrested:

2 are employees of Olympiakos Football Club

1 is the son of a Police Officer

1 is a nephew of a Greek Parliament Member

1 is a public officer
